Quick view Add to Cart The item has been added Verdura 18K Double Wrap Curb-Link Necklace (VED20706) MSRP: Was: Now: C$70,577.58
Quick view Add to Cart The item has been added 18K Curb Link Chain Necklace 22511641 MSRP: Was: Now: C$4,004.35
Quick view Add to Cart The item has been added Verdura Curb-Link Bracelet Watch 18140805 MSRP: Was: Now: C$25,251.92
Quick view Add to Cart The item has been added Verdura 18K Pietersite & Diamond Bead Necklace 25674615 MSRP: Was: Now: C$6,314.84
Quick view Add to Cart The item has been added Verdura 18K Rose Quartz Torsade Necklace 16529504 MSRP: Was: Now: C$10,393.48